Brazil Proposes National Bitcoin Reserve, Targets 1 Million BTC Over Five Years
Summary
Brazilian lawmakers have proposed a bill to create a national Strategic Sovereign Bitcoin Reserve, named RESBit, with the goal of gradually acquiring 1,000,000 BTC over five years. The legislation, introduced by Federal Deputy Luiz Gastão, outlines a framework for integrating Bitcoin into national financial strategy, including prohibiting the sale of judicially seized bitcoins and allowing federal taxes to be paid in Bitcoin. The proposal also incentivizes public companies for Bitcoin mining and storage, mandates public disclosure of holdings, and requires secure storage using technologies like cold and multisignature wallets. If approved, Brazil would join a select group of nations holding national Bitcoin reserves. This move follows similar explorations by countries like El Salvador, the US (at state and federal levels), the Czech National Bank, and others considering national frameworks for digital asset reserves.
